Find the equation of a line that passes through the point (0,5) and has a gradient of 3. Leave your answer in the form y = m x + c.

Answers

Answer 1

The equation of a line with point (0,5) and gradient 3 in the form of y = mx + c is y = 3x + 5.

The point slope form of the equation to be used for finding the equation is -

y - [tex] y_{1}[/tex] = m (x - [tex] x_{1}[/tex] )

As per the mentioned information, m or slope is 3, [tex] y_{1}[/tex] is 5 and [tex] x_{1}[/tex] is 0. Keep the values in point slope form to find the equation.

y - 5 = 3 (x - 0)

Performing multiplication on Right Hand Side

y - 5 = 3x - 0

Shifting 5 to Right Hand Side

y = 3x + 5

Thus, the answer is y = 3x + 5.

for a given arithmetic sequence, the first term a1 is equal to 28 and the 93r term is equal to -432 find the value of the 33rd term a33

Answers

The 33rd term of the given Arithmetic progression will be -132.

What is an Arithmetic progression?

A series of numbers is called a "arithmetic progression" (AP) when any two subsequent numbers have a constant difference. Arithmetic Sequence is another name for it.

Given, first term= a1= 28

and, a93 = -432

we know that, a93 = -432

                   a + 92d = -432 (where d is the common difference)

                  28 + 92d = -432

                     92d = -432-28

                             = -460

                       d = -460/92 = -5.

Now, we can find the a33,

               a33 = a + 32d

                       = 28 + (32× -5)

                       = 28-160

                       = -132.

4. How high must an individual score on the GMAT in order to score in the
highest 5%? (Round to the nearest whole number)

Answers

The scores needed in order to score in the highest 5% of the GMAT are given as follows:

At least 711.

How to obtain the score using the normal distribution?

The z-score of a measure X of a variable that has mean symbolized by [tex]\mu[/tex] and standard deviation symbolized by [tex]\sigma[/tex] is obtained by the rule presented as follows:

[tex]Z = \frac{X - \mu}{\sigma}[/tex]

The z-score represents how many standard deviations the measure X is above or below the mean of the distribution, depending if the obtained z-score is positive or negative.Using the z-score table, the p-value associated with the calculated z-score is found, and it represents the percentile of the measure X in the distribution.

The mean and the standard deviation of GMAT scores are given as follows:

µ = 527, σ = 112.

The highest 5% of scores are composed by scores of the 95th percentile and above, hence the minimum score is X when Z = 1.645.

Then:

1.645 = (X - 527)/112

X - 527 = 1.645 x 112

X = 711.
